How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Kingsway West?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Kingsway West Studio Apartments | $1,046 | $569 | $3,000 |
Kingsway West 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,586 | $660 | $3,800 |
Kingsway West 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,146 | $725 | $6,577 |
Kingsway West 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,594 | $1,000 | $3,000 |
Kingsway West 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,441 | $1,450 | $3,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Kingsway West
How much are Studio apartments in Kingsway West?
There are currently 83 Studio Apartments in Kingsway West with rent ranges from $569 to $3,000 with an average price of $1,046.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Kingsway West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Kingsway West ranges from $660 to $3,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,586.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Kingsway West c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Kingsway West range from $725 to $6,577.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,146.
How expensive are Kingsway West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 60 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Kingsway West on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 - averaging $1,594 for the location.
